+#include "instructions.h"
+#include "registers.h"
+#include <elf.h>
+#include <err.h>
+#include <stdio.h>
+#include <stdlib.h>
+#include <string.h>
+
+unsigned char some_opcodes[] = {MOVDI(REG_EAX, 0x3c),
+ // 0xb8, 0x3c, 0x00, 0x00, 0x00,
+ MOVDI(REG_EDI, 0x41),
+ // 0xbf, 0x41, 0x00, 0x00, 0x00,
+ SYSCALL};
+unsigned int some_opcodes_len = sizeof(some_opcodes) / sizeof(some_opcodes[0]);
+
+int
+write_elf(char* restrict file, size_t opcodes_len, char* restrict opcodes) {
+ int error = 0;
+
+ Elf64_Phdr header_program[] = {
+ //{
+ // .p_type = PT_LOAD,
+ // .p_flags = PF_R,
+ // .p_offset = 0, /* Segment file offset */
+ // .p_vaddr = 0x400000, /* Segment virtual address */
+ // .p_paddr = 0x400000, /* Segment physical address */
+ // .p_filesz = 0xb0, /* Segment size in file */
+ // .p_memsz = 0xb0, /* Segment size in memory */
+ // .p_align = 0x1000, /* Segment alignment */
+ //},
+ {
+ .p_type = PT_LOAD,
+ .p_flags = PF_X | PF_R,
+ .p_offset =
+ sizeof(Elf64_Ehdr) + sizeof(Elf64_Phdr), /* Segment file offset */
+ .p_vaddr = 0x400000 + sizeof(Elf64_Ehdr) +
+ sizeof(Elf64_Phdr), /* Segment virtual address */
+ .p_paddr = 0x400000 + sizeof(Elf64_Ehdr) +
+ sizeof(Elf64_Phdr), /* Segment physical address */
+ .p_filesz = opcodes_len, /* Segment size in file */
+ .p_memsz = opcodes_len, /* Segment size in memory */
+ .p_align = 0x1, /* Segment alignment */
+ },
+ };
+
+ Elf64_Shdr header_section[] = {
+ {
+ // .init
+ // Index in section header string table
+ .sh_name = 0,
+ .sh_type = 0,
+ .sh_flags = 0,
+ .sh_addr = 0,
+ .sh_offset = 0,
+ .sh_size = 0,
+ .sh_link = 0,
+ .sh_info = 0,
+ .sh_addralign = 0,
+ .sh_entsize = 0,
+ },
+ {
+ // .init
+ // Index in section header string table
+ .sh_name = 0,
+ .sh_type = SHT_PROGBITS,
+ .sh_flags = SHF_ALLOC | SHF_EXECINSTR,
+ .sh_addr = 0x401000,
+ .sh_offset = 0x1000,
+ .sh_size = opcodes_len,
+ /* todo: deps on type */
+ .sh_link = 0,
+ /* todo: deps on type */
+ .sh_info = 0,
+ .sh_addralign = 4,
+ .sh_entsize = 0,
+ },
+ {
+ // .shstrtab Section Header String Table
+ // Index in section header string table
+ .sh_name = 1,
+ .sh_type = SHT_STRTAB,
+ .sh_flags = 0,
+ .sh_addr = 0x100,
+ .sh_offset = 0x2000,
+ .sh_size = opcodes_len,
+ /* todo: deps on type */
+ .sh_link = 0,
+ /* todo: deps on type */
+ .sh_info = 0,
+ .sh_addralign = 1,
+ .sh_entsize = 0,
+ },
+ };
+
+ unsigned char string_header_table[] = {0, '.', 'i', 'n', 'i', 't', 0};
+
+ Elf64_Ehdr header = {
+ // memset(&header, 0, sizeof(Elf64_Ehdr));
+ .e_ident = {ELFMAG0, ELFMAG1, ELFMAG2, ELFMAG3, ELFCLASS64, ELFDATA2LSB,
+ EV_CURRENT, ELFOSABI_SYSV},
+ .e_type = ET_EXEC,
+ .e_machine = EM_X86_64,
+ .e_version = EV_CURRENT,
+ .e_entry = 0x400000 + sizeof(Elf64_Ehdr) +
+ sizeof(Elf64_Phdr), // point to VIRTUAL address of _start
+ .e_phoff = sizeof(Elf64_Ehdr) /* Program header table offset */,
+ .e_shoff = 0, // sizeof(Elf64_Ehdr) + sizeof(header_program) /* Section
+ // header table offset */,
+ .e_flags = 0,
+ .e_ehsize = sizeof(Elf64_Ehdr),
+ .e_phentsize = sizeof(Elf64_Phdr),
+ // If larger than PN_XNUM, then set to PN_XNUM and store real number in
+ // sh_info of first program header entry
+ .e_phnum = 1,
+ .e_shentsize = sizeof(header_section[0]),
+ // If larger than SHN_LORESERVE, then set to 0 and store real number in
+ // sh_size of first section header entry
+ .e_shnum = 0, // sizeof(header_section) / sizeof(header_section[0]),
+ // If larger than SHN_LORESERVE, then set to SHN_XINDEX and store real index
+ // in
+ // sh_link of first section header entry
+ .e_shstrndx = 0,
+ };
+
+ size_t bytes_written = 0;
+ FILE* fd = fopen(file, "w");
+
+ fwrite(&header, sizeof(Elf64_Ehdr), 1, fd);
+ fwrite(&header_program, sizeof(Elf64_Phdr),
+ sizeof(header_program) / sizeof(header_program[0]), fd);
+ // fseek(fd, 0x1000, SEEK_SET);
+
+ do {
+ bytes_written += fwrite(opcodes, sizeof(char), opcodes_len, fd);
+ } while (bytes_written != opcodes_len);
+ error = fclose(fd);
+ if (error) {
+ err(EXIT_FAILURE, "no way");
+ }
+ return 0;
+}
